Tips to Avoid Pickleball Injuries: In 2024, injuries from pickleball led to over $350 million in medical expenses, particularly impacting players over 50 years old. Fractures have significantly increased among this age group, as 90% of hospital visits related to the sport were for older players. Preventive measures are crucial for safety.

Injury Trends Among Older Players
Pickleball, a popular sport among all ages, poses high injury risks, especially for players aged 50 and above. The increase in injuries has prompted concern among health professionals and sports organizations. Experts urge players to be aware of the risks and take necessary precautions before playing.
Importance of Preventive Measures
To help reduce injury risks, players are encouraged to focus on proper warm-ups, good technique, and appropriate footwear. These preventive measures can significantly lower the chance of injuries while enhancing overall performance.
Significance of the Findings
The substantial costs associated with pickleball injuries highlight the need for increased awareness and education about safety measures in the sport.
As pickleball continues to grow in popularity, especially among older adults, it is crucial for players to prioritize safety to reduce injury rates.
